中文亚洲精品无码_熟女乱子伦免费_人人超碰人人爱国产_亚洲熟妇女综合网

當(dāng)前位置: 首頁(yè) > news >正文

專(zhuān)業(yè)網(wǎng)站建設(shè)模板怎么在百度推廣自己的網(wǎng)站

專(zhuān)業(yè)網(wǎng)站建設(shè)模板,怎么在百度推廣自己的網(wǎng)站,python簡(jiǎn)單小游戲代碼,網(wǎng)站 圖片延時(shí)加載文章目錄 一.Git是什么二.核心概念三.工作流程四.Git的優(yōu)勢(shì) 下載Git 推薦官網(wǎng)下載 官網(wǎng)地址 一.Git是什么 Git是一個(gè)分布式版本控制系統(tǒng),用于跟蹤文件的變化并協(xié)調(diào)多人對(duì)同一項(xiàng)目的開(kāi)發(fā)工作。它就像是一個(gè)時(shí)光機(jī)器,能夠記錄文件在不同時(shí)間點(diǎn)的狀態(tài)&…

文章目錄

    • 一.Git是什么
    • 二.核心概念
    • 三.工作流程
    • 四.Git的優(yōu)勢(shì)

下載Git 推薦官網(wǎng)下載
官網(wǎng)地址

一.Git是什么

Git是一個(gè)分布式版本控制系統(tǒng),用于跟蹤文件的變化并協(xié)調(diào)多人對(duì)同一項(xiàng)目的開(kāi)發(fā)工作。它就像是一個(gè)時(shí)光機(jī)器,能夠記錄文件在不同時(shí)間點(diǎn)的狀態(tài),讓開(kāi)發(fā)者可以回溯文件的歷史版本,比較不同版本之間的差異,以及輕松地恢復(fù)到之前的某個(gè)狀態(tài)。

二.核心概念

  1. 倉(cāng)庫(kù)(Repository)
    • 倉(cāng)庫(kù)是Git用于存儲(chǔ)項(xiàng)目文件及其版本歷史的地方??梢园阉胂蟪梢粋€(gè)裝滿(mǎn)了文件各個(gè)版本的箱子。倉(cāng)庫(kù)分為本地倉(cāng)庫(kù)(存在于開(kāi)發(fā)者自己的計(jì)算機(jī)上)和遠(yuǎn)程倉(cāng)庫(kù)(通常存儲(chǔ)在服務(wù)器上,如GitHub、GitLab等平臺(tái))。
    • 例如,在開(kāi)發(fā)一個(gè)軟件項(xiàng)目時(shí),本地倉(cāng)庫(kù)用于開(kāi)發(fā)者在自己的電腦上進(jìn)行代碼的編寫(xiě)、修改和版本控制。而遠(yuǎn)程倉(cāng)庫(kù)則用于團(tuán)隊(duì)成員之間共享代碼,方便多人協(xié)作開(kāi)發(fā)。
  2. 提交(Commit)
    • 提交是Git中保存文件版本的操作。當(dāng)開(kāi)發(fā)者對(duì)文件進(jìn)行了一系列的修改,并且這些修改達(dá)到了一個(gè)相對(duì)完整的階段(比如完成了一個(gè)功能或者修復(fù)了一個(gè)bug),就可以將這些修改作為一個(gè)提交保存到倉(cāng)庫(kù)中。
    • 每個(gè)提交都有一個(gè)唯一的標(biāo)識(shí)符(SHA - 1哈希值),并且包含了提交的作者、日期、提交說(shuō)明等信息。例如,一個(gè)提交說(shuō)明可能是“實(shí)現(xiàn)用戶(hù)登錄功能”,這樣其他開(kāi)發(fā)者在查看版本歷史時(shí)就能清楚地知道這個(gè)提交的目的。
  3. 分支(Branch)
    • 分支是倉(cāng)庫(kù)中獨(dú)立的開(kāi)發(fā)線??梢曰诂F(xiàn)有的分支創(chuàng)建新的分支,在新分支上進(jìn)行開(kāi)發(fā)而不影響其他分支。這就好比是在一條主道路上開(kāi)辟出的小岔路,開(kāi)發(fā)者可以在岔路上進(jìn)行實(shí)驗(yàn)性的開(kāi)發(fā)或者開(kāi)發(fā)新的功能。
    • 例如,在開(kāi)發(fā)一個(gè)網(wǎng)站時(shí),有一個(gè)主分支(mastermain)用于保存穩(wěn)定的、可以發(fā)布的代碼。同時(shí),可以創(chuàng)建一個(gè)feature - login分支用于開(kāi)發(fā)用戶(hù)登錄功能,一個(gè)bug - fix - navbar分支用于修復(fù)導(dǎo)航欄的問(wèn)題等。
  4. 合并(Merge)和變基(Rebase)
    • 當(dāng)在不同分支上完成開(kāi)發(fā)后,需要將這些分支的修改合并到主分支或者其他分支上。合并是將兩個(gè)分支的修改整合到一起的操作。變基則是一種修改提交歷史的方式,它可以讓提交歷史看起來(lái)更加線性。
    • 例如,在feature - login分支完成用戶(hù)登錄功能開(kāi)發(fā)后,可以將這個(gè)分支合并到master分支,使master分支包含登錄功能的更新。變基操作通常用于整理提交歷史,比如將多個(gè)小的提交合并為一個(gè)更有意義的提交,或者將分支的提交移動(dòng)到主分支提交的后面,使提交歷史更加清晰。

三.工作流程

  1. 初始化倉(cāng)庫(kù)
    • 可以使用git init命令在本地創(chuàng)建一個(gè)新的Git倉(cāng)庫(kù),或者使用git clone命令從遠(yuǎn)程倉(cāng)庫(kù)克隆一個(gè)副本到本地。例如,在一個(gè)新的項(xiàng)目文件夾中執(zhí)行git init,就會(huì)在這個(gè)文件夾中創(chuàng)建一個(gè)隱藏的.git文件夾,它包含了倉(cāng)庫(kù)的所有版本控制信息。
  2. 修改文件和暫存(Staging)
    • 開(kāi)發(fā)者對(duì)文件進(jìn)行修改后,使用git add命令將修改后的文件添加到暫存區(qū)。暫存區(qū)就像是一個(gè)準(zhǔn)備提交的區(qū)域,它可以讓開(kāi)發(fā)者選擇哪些修改要包含在下次提交中。例如,修改了一個(gè)代碼文件和一個(gè)配置文件后,可以使用git add.將當(dāng)前目錄下的所有修改添加到暫存區(qū)。
  3. 提交(Commit)
    • 使用git commit命令將暫存區(qū)的文件提交到本地倉(cāng)庫(kù)。在提交時(shí),需要提供一個(gè)提交說(shuō)明來(lái)描述這次提交的內(nèi)容。例如,git commit -m "優(yōu)化數(shù)據(jù)庫(kù)查詢(xún)性能"會(huì)將暫存區(qū)的文件作為一個(gè)新的提交保存到本地倉(cāng)庫(kù),并附上提交說(shuō)明。
  4. 推送(Push)和拉取(Pull)
    • 為了與團(tuán)隊(duì)成員協(xié)作,需要將本地倉(cāng)庫(kù)的提交推送到遠(yuǎn)程倉(cāng)庫(kù)(使用git push命令),也需要從遠(yuǎn)程倉(cāng)庫(kù)獲取其他成員的提交(使用git pullgit fetch命令)。例如,在完成一個(gè)功能的開(kāi)發(fā)并提交到本地倉(cāng)庫(kù)后,使用git push origin feature - loginfeature - login分支的提交推送到遠(yuǎn)程倉(cāng)庫(kù)的feature - login分支。

四.Git的優(yōu)勢(shì)

  1. 分布式協(xié)作
    • 每個(gè)開(kāi)發(fā)者都擁有整個(gè)項(xiàng)目倉(cāng)庫(kù)的完整副本,包括所有的版本歷史。這使得開(kāi)發(fā)者即使在沒(méi)有網(wǎng)絡(luò)連接的情況下也能繼續(xù)工作,并且可以方便地與其他開(kāi)發(fā)者共享代碼。例如,在一個(gè)跨國(guó)團(tuán)隊(duì)中,不同地區(qū)的開(kāi)發(fā)者可以各自在本地倉(cāng)庫(kù)進(jìn)行開(kāi)發(fā),然后定期將自己的修改推送到遠(yuǎn)程倉(cāng)庫(kù)與其他成員共享。
  2. 版本控制和歷史記錄
    • Git能夠詳細(xì)地記錄文件的版本變化,這對(duì)于追蹤問(wèn)題、查看功能的開(kāi)發(fā)過(guò)程以及回滾到之前的版本非常有用。例如,當(dāng)發(fā)現(xiàn)新上線的功能導(dǎo)致了系統(tǒng)故障時(shí),可以通過(guò)Git的版本歷史快速定位到引入問(wèn)題的提交,并將項(xiàng)目回滾到之前穩(wěn)定的版本。
  3. 分支管理
    • 靈活的分支管理功能允許開(kāi)發(fā)者同時(shí)進(jìn)行多個(gè)功能的開(kāi)發(fā)、實(shí)驗(yàn)新的想法,并且可以輕松地合并或放棄這些分支。這有助于提高開(kāi)發(fā)效率,降低開(kāi)發(fā)過(guò)程中的風(fēng)險(xiǎn)。例如,在開(kāi)發(fā)一個(gè)大型軟件時(shí),可以通過(guò)創(chuàng)建多個(gè)分支來(lái)并行開(kāi)發(fā)不同的模塊,最后將這些分支的成果合并到主分支中。
http://www.risenshineclean.com/news/9588.html

相關(guān)文章:

  • 購(gòu)物網(wǎng)站的圖片輪播怎么做短鏈接在線生成官網(wǎng)
  • 找別人做公司網(wǎng)站第一步做什么最新網(wǎng)站推廣方法
  • 做網(wǎng)站哪些公司好百度分析
  • 常德網(wǎng)站建設(shè)案例教程360優(yōu)化大師app
  • 自己做網(wǎng)站 為什么出現(xiàn)403營(yíng)銷(xiāo)渠道名詞解釋
  • 使用他人注冊(cè)商標(biāo)做網(wǎng)站湖南網(wǎng)站托管
  • 醫(yī)療器械做網(wǎng)站到哪里先備案網(wǎng)絡(luò)營(yíng)銷(xiāo)方法
  • 黔東網(wǎng)站建設(shè)什么網(wǎng)站都能打開(kāi)的瀏覽器
  • 聊天網(wǎng)站制作教程武漢seo廣告推廣
  • 淮北網(wǎng)站建設(shè)制作衡陽(yáng)網(wǎng)站優(yōu)化公司
  • 旅游網(wǎng)站模板源碼媒體發(fā)稿網(wǎng)
  • 最新中國(guó)b2b網(wǎng)站排名南寧seo做法哪家好
  • 獨(dú)立網(wǎng)站怎么做seo當(dāng)陽(yáng)seo外包
  • php 開(kāi)源企業(yè)網(wǎng)站百度網(wǎng)盤(pán)網(wǎng)頁(yè)版入口
  • 懷化 網(wǎng)站建設(shè)2345網(wǎng)址導(dǎo)航設(shè)為主頁(yè)
  • 合肥萬(wàn)戶(hù)網(wǎng)絡(luò)科技有限公司搜索引擎優(yōu)化的主要工作
  • 上虞網(wǎng)站設(shè)計(jì)城關(guān)網(wǎng)站seo
  • 沈陽(yáng)做網(wǎng)站公司重慶seo排名
  • 國(guó)內(nèi)課程網(wǎng)站建設(shè)現(xiàn)狀永久免費(fèi)低代碼開(kāi)發(fā)平臺(tái)
  • 新華社兩學(xué)一做網(wǎng)站seo整合營(yíng)銷(xiāo)
  • 編輯網(wǎng)站內(nèi)容有沒(méi)有批量辦法什么是seo關(guān)鍵詞
  • 網(wǎng)站程序和空間區(qū)別網(wǎng)絡(luò)推廣優(yōu)化網(wǎng)站
  • 寧波網(wǎng)站建設(shè)推廣公司青島百度快速排名優(yōu)化
  • 零食網(wǎng)站頁(yè)面模板湖南專(zhuān)業(yè)seo公司
  • 房產(chǎn)信息網(wǎng)站模板電商平臺(tái)怎么加入
  • 音樂(lè)網(wǎng)站開(kāi)發(fā)參考文獻(xiàn)百度指數(shù)代表什么意思
  • 雞西公司做網(wǎng)站關(guān)鍵詞分為哪幾類(lèi)
  • 哪有專(zhuān)做注冊(cè)小網(wǎng)站的客戶(hù)資源買(mǎi)賣(mài)平臺(tái)
  • wordpress懸浮bar深圳seo網(wǎng)站優(yōu)化公司
  • 企業(yè)網(wǎng)站怎么做推廣比較好網(wǎng)站模板建站公司